TOPIC: Dorothea Orem’s Theory

Summary of the report

Dorothea Orem’s Theory developed the Self-Care Deficit Theory of Nursing, which is

composed of three interrelated theories: (1) the theory of self-care, (2) the self-care deficit

theory, and (3) the theory of nursing systems. She also tackles about The Three Basic Nursing

Systems; these are the wholly compensatory nursing system, the partly compensatory nursing

system, and the supportive-educative system. This theory requires special knowledge , skills

which deals on meeting the client’s needs.

Learning’s

Dorthea Orem described her Theory of Self-Care as the performance or practice of activities that

individuals initiate and perform on their own behalf to maintain life, health and well-being. She

sets the definition of self-care deficit as Self-care Deficit delineates when nursing is needed it

also explains that deficit defends on how much care is needed by the patient. According to her

nursing is required to respond towards the patients’ needs it shall provide all the needs of the

patients but with the certain limits and in accordance to their inability to function. Dorethea

Orem also describes the theory of nursing systems as the product of a series of relations between

the nurse and his/her patients. This system is activated when the client’s therapeutic self-care

demand exceeds available self-care agency, leading to the need for nursing. Then the three basic

nursing systems. The wholly compensatory nursing system is represented by a situation in which

the individual is unable to engage in those self-care actions requiring self-directed and controlled

ambulation and manipulative movement or the medical prescription to refrain from such

activity. Persons with these limitations are socially dependent on others for their continued

existence and well-being. Then the partly compensatory nursing system is represented by a

situation in which both nurse and perform care measures or other actions involving manipulative

tasks or ambulation. The patient or the nurse may have the major role in the performance of care

measures. While the supportive-educative system also known as supportive-developmental


system, the person is able to perform or can and should learn to perform required measures of

externally or internally oriented therapeutic self-care but cannot do so without assistance.
